Based on your response to the Reregistration Eligibility Document( s), EPA has reregistered the product
|
||
listed above provided that the following change is made to the label:
|
||
I. Add the word, ONLY the the end of the phrase, "For use by cOIllinercial seed treaters." (page
|
||
I)
|
||
2. Delete COIllina (,) from chem.ical name in the ingredient statement (page 1)
|
||
3. Delete the phrase beginning, "Prolonged or frequently repeated skin contact. .. " from the
|
||
precautionary statements and add the following, "Remove contaminated clothing and wash
|
||
before reuse."
|
||
Signature of Approving Official:
|
||
Ma~lr;:;, ~nager (21)
|
||
Fungicide Branch, Regist~ation Division
|
||
EPA. form 8570-6
|
||
Continued on page 2
|
||
Date:
|
||
|
||
Page 2
|
||
Notice of Reregistration
|
||
EPA Reg No 2935-427
|
||
4. Delete the following sentence from the resistance NOTE (page I), "Therefore, Wilber-Ellis cannot
|
||
assume liability for crop damage resulting from resistant strains of fungi."
|
||
5. Add the following Groundwater Advisory statement below Environmental Hazards statement:
|
||
This chemical is known to leach through the soil into groundwater under certain conditions as
|
||
a result of agricultural use. Use of this chemical in areas where soils are permeable,
|
||
particularly where the water table is shallow, may result in groundwater contamination.
|
||
6. Revise the NOTE on page 2 to read:
|
||
Label treated spinach seed with the additional statement: "Do not use seed for spinach destined
|
||
to be grown ill the greenhouse."
|
||
7. In the Storage and Disposal section (page 4), add the word Pesticide after 2. before "Storage."
|
||
8. Delete #5 and associated sentence within the storage and disposal section (page 4).
|
||
9. Conditions of Sale and Limitation of Warranty and Liability section (page 4):
|
||
• Change the word should to must in the second paragraph
|
||
• Add the phrase, "To tbe extent consistent witb applicable law," to precede the following
|
||
statements begirming, "All such risks ... ,"" Except for this warranty ... ," "Buyer and User
|
||
accept all risks ... ," and "The exclusive remedy of the buyer or user. .. "
|
||
This action is taken under the authority of section 4(g)(2)( c) of the Federal Insecticide, Fungicide, and
|
||
Rodenticide Act, as amended. Reregistration under this section does not eliminate the need for continual
|
||
reassessment of pesticides. EPA may require submission of data at any time to maintain the registration of
|
||
your product.

APRON @ FLOWABLE
|
||
SEED TREATMENT FUNGICIDE
|
||
A seed treatment chemical for control of seed rot
|
||
and damping-off diseases of certain crops.
|
||
FOR USE BY COMMERCIAL SEED TREATERS
|
||
A::;TIVE INGREDIENT
|
||
Metalaxyl. N·(2,6·dimethylphenyl)-N-(methoxyacetyl)-
|
||
alanine, methyl ester ............. .. ....................... 28.35%
|
||
OTHER INGREDIENTS ............... . .............. 71.65%
|
||
TOTAL. .100.00%
|
||
Contains 2.65 po.mds Metalaxyl per gallon.
|
||
EPA Est No. 2935-CA-1
|
||
KEEP OUT OF REACH OF CHILDREN
|
||
CAUTION
|
||
FIRST AID
|
||
Have the product container or label with you when calling a poison control center or doctor. or going for treatment.
|
||
IF SWALLOWED: -Call a pOison control center or doctor immediately for treatment advice.
|
||
-Have person SIp a glass of water if able to swallow.
|
||
-Do not induce vomiting unless told to do so b)! a poison control center or doctor
|
||
-Do not give anything by mouth to an unconscious person.
|
||
IF ON SKIN -Take off contaminated clothing.
|
||
OR CLOTHING: -Rmse skin Immediately with plenty of water for 15-20 minutes.
|
||
-Call a poison control center or doctorfor treatment advice.
|
||
PRECAUTIONARY STATEMENTS
|
||
HAZARDS TO HUMANS AND DOMESTIC ANIMALS
|
||
CAUTION: Harmful if Swallowed or absorbed through skin. Avoid contact with skin, eyes or clothing. Prolonged or frequently
|
||
repsated skin contact may cause allergic reactions ie some individuals. Wash thoroughly with soap and water after handling.
|
||
ENVIRONMENTAL HAZARDS
|
||
Do not apply directly to water. orto areas where surface water is present or to imertidal areas below the mean high water mark.
|
||
Do not contaminate water when disposing of equipment washwater. This chemical is known to leach through soil into ground-
|
||
water under certain conditions as a result of agricultural use. Use of this chemical in areas where soils are permeable,
|
||
particularly where the water table is shallow, may result in ground water contaminations.
|
||
NOTE: W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E is a systemic fungicide having a specific mode of action. WILBUR-ELLIS APRON
|
||
FLOWABLE could be subject to development of resistant strains of fungi. Development of resistance cannot be predicted.
|
||
Therefore, WILBUR-ELLIS cannot assume liaDility for crop damage resulting from resistant strains offungi. Consult your State
|
||
Agricultural Experiment Station or Extension Service specialist for guidance and ways to control any possible WILBUR-ELLIS
|
||
APRDN FLOWABLE resistant strains of fungi which may occur.

SEED TREATMENT - DOMESTIC USE
|
||
CARROTS: For pythlum damping-off control, ap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ed treatment at the rate of 0.75
|
||
II. oz per 100 pounds of seed.
|
||
COTTON: For Pythium seed rot and damping-off, ap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ed treatment to machine
|
||
dellnted or aCid-delinted cottonseed at the rate 010,75-1.50 ft. oz. per 100 pounds of seed.
|
||
FORAGE GRASSES (All except scarified Bermuda): Grasses grown lor hay, grazing or silage, corn (ladder or silage) and small
|
||
grains grown lor hay, grazing or silage
|
||
For Pythium damping-off control ap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ed treatment at the rate 010.75 ft. oz. per 100
|
||
pounds of seed.
|
||
FORAGE LEGUMES: Allalfa, clover, lespedeza, beans (lor lorage), soybeans (forlorage), soybean hay, peas (lor forage), pea vine
|
||
hay, cowpeas (for forage), cowpea hay, trefoil, vetch and velvet beans (for foragel.
|
||
For Pythium damping-off ap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ed treatment at the rate of 0.75 to 1.50 ft. oz. per 100
|
||
pounds of seed.
|
||
For early season Phytophthora ap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ed treatment at the rate of 1.50 fl. oz. per 100
|
||
pounds of seed.
|
||
GARDEN BEETS: For control of Pythium damping-off, ap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ed treatment at the rate
|
||
of 0.75 II. oz. per 100 pounds of seed,
|
||
GRAIN CROPS: Wheat, barley, rye, oats, millet, rice, corn (field corn, sweet corn, and popcorn), buckwheat and triticale. For
|
||
Pythium damping-off control, ap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ed treatment at the rate of 0.75 II. oz. per 100
|
||
pounds of seed.
|
||
For control of systemic downy mildew of sweet corn, ap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ed treatment at the rate
|
||
of 1,50 fl. oz. per 100 pounds of seed.
|
||
PEANUTS: For Pythium damping-off control, ap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ed treatment at the rate of 0.75
|
||
fl. oz. per 100 pounds of seed.
|
||
SEED AND POD VEGETABLES: Black-eyed peas, cowpeas dill, edible soybeans, field beans, chick peas (garbanzo beans), field
|
||
peas, garden peas, green beans, kidney beans, lima beans, navy beans, okra, peas, pole beans, snap beans, string beans, wax
|
||
beans, lentils and lupines.
|
||
For Pythium damping-off and early season Phytophthora control, ap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ed treatment
|
||
at the rate of 0,75 fl. oz, per 100 pounds of seed.
|
||
For control of Pythium damping-off and systemic downy mildew of peas, ap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ed
|
||
treatment at the rate of 1.50 fl. oz. per 100 pounds of seed.

APRON FLOWABLE, Page 3 of 4
|
||
SORGHUM: For control of Pyt'llum damping-off oc disease resistant sorghum cultlvars. use 0.75 II oz per 100 pounds 01 seed
|
||
applied as a seed treatment.
|
||
For contro; of Pythlum damping-off oro non-disease resistant sorghum cultrvars, use 1.5 fi. oz, per 1 O~ pounds of seed applied as
|
||
a seed treatment.
|
||
For Pythium damping-off control when less disease pressure is expected, apply WILBUR-ELLIS APROJ'.: FLOWABLE as a seed
|
||
treatment at the rate of 0 11-0.41 fi. oz. per 100 pounds of seed In combination with WILBUR-ELLIS Captan products at labeled
|
||
ra~es
|
||
For control of systemic downy mildew, apply 0.75 II. oz. of W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E per 100 pounds of seed on
|
||
c;Jitrvars which possess sorghum downy mildew resistance
|
||
To those cultrvars which do not possess resistance to a particular race of sorghum downy mildew in heavily Infected areas with
|
||
recent severe hiStOry, apply 1.50 II 02 of W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E per 100 pounds of seed as a seed treatment.
|
||
Only high quality sorghum seed (90% germ and above) should be treated with W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E.
|
||
SOYBEANS: For Pythlurn dampl"g-ofi and early season Phytophthora control, ap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FlOWABLE as a
|
||
seed treatment at the rate of 0.75-1.50 fl. oz. per 100 pounds of seed.
|
||
For Pythium damping-off control when less disease is expected, ap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ed treatment
|
||
at the rate of 0.11-0.41 fl. oz. per 100 pouods of seed In combination with WILBUR-ELLIS Captan or another registered seed
|
||
treatment product.
|
||
SPINACH: For Pythium damping-off control, ap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ON =LOWABLE as a seed treatITent at the rate of O. 75
|
||
fI oz. per 100 pounds of seed.
|
||
Do not apply to spinach which IS to be grown In greenhouses. Containers or bags containing Apron treated seed must be labeled
|
||
with the restriction, "Do not use spinach seed for greenhouse planting".
|
||
SUGAR BEETS: For Pythlum damping-off control, ap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ed treatment at the rate of
|
||
0.75 II. 02. per 100 pounds of seed
|
||
SUNFLOWER: For control of systemic downy mildew, ap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ed treatment at the rate
|
||
of 3.00 II. oz. per 100 pounds of seed.
|
||
TURF GRASSES (All except scarified Bermuda): For Pythium damping-off control on golf courses. home lawns, reclamalion
|
||
and erosion control projects. apply WILBUR-ELLIS APROJ'.: FLOWASLE as 2 seed treatme"! at the rate 0' 1.50 f:. 0:. per 100
|
||
pounds of seed.
|
||
SEED TREATMENT·· EXPORT USE
|
||
Seed treated in accordance with the export use pattern must be labeled as follows: For Export Only, Not for Domestic Sale or Use.
|
||
NOTE: Federal law reqUires that bags containing treated seeds shall be labeled with the following information: 'This seed has been
|
||
treated with metalaxyl fungicide. Do not use for feed, food, or oil purposes. Store away from feeds and foodstuffs." Use with an EPA
|
||
approved dye or colorant that imparts an unnatural color to the seed.
|
||
BRASSICA(COLE) LEAFY VEGETABLES: For P)1hium damping-off control, ap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a
|
||
seed treatment at the rate of 1.4 7 fl. oz. per 100 pouods of seed.
|
||
CORN: For control 01 Pythium damping-off of corn, ap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ed treatment at the rate of
|
||
1.47 fl. oz. per 1 00 pounds of seed. For control of systemic downey mildew ap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ed
|
||
treatment at the rate of 3.00 II. oZ. per 100 pounds of seed.
|
||
CUCURBITS: For Pythium damping-off control, ap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ed treatment at the rate of 0.75
|
||
fl. oz. per 100 pounds of seed.
|
||
FRUITING VEGETABLES: For pythium damping-off control, ap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ed treatment at
|
||
the rate of 1.47 II. oz. per 100 pounds of seed.
|
||
LEAFY VEGETABLES: For Pytlllum damping-off control, ap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ed treatment at the
|
||
rate of 1.47 fl. oz. per 100 pounds of seed.
|
||
NOTE; Do not apply to spinach to be grown in greenhouses. Containers or bags of spinach seed must be labeled with the
|
||
restriction "Do not use spinach seed for greenhouse planting."
|
||
MILLET: For control of Pythium damping-off apply WILBUR-ELLIS APR 0 J'.: FLOVVABLE as a seed treatment at the rate of 1.47 fi.
|
||
oz. per 100 pounds of seed. For control of systemic downey mildew ap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ed
|
||
treatment at the rate of 2.52 fi. oz. per '00 poun:!s of seed
|
||
ONIONS: Foe Pythium damping-off control appl" W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ed treatment at the rate of 1.47 fi.
|
||
oz. per 100 pounds of seed.
|
||
|
||
f-/C;;I I VV f-/VUIIU;:' UI :;'CCU.
|
||
ROOT AND TUBER VEGETABLES: For Pythium damping-off control, ap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ed
|
||
treatment at the rate of 1.4 7 fl. oz. per 100 pounds of seed.
|
||
NOTE: Do not ap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E to potatoes.
|
||
SORGHUM: For Pythium damping-off control, ap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ed treatment at the rate of 1.50
|
||
fl. oz. per 100 pounds of seed.
|
||
For systemic downy mildew control, ap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ed treatment at the rate of 4.50 fl. oz. per
|
||
100 pounds of seed.
|
||
SUNFLOWER: For control of systemic downy mildew, apply WILBUR-ELLIS APRON FLOWABLE as a seed treatment at the
|
||
rate of 6.00 - 9.00 fl. oz. per 100 pounds of seed.
|
